Курс изучения Ruby для начинающих
маркетплейс образовательных курсов
Приступаем к изучению языка Ruby для начинающих. В ходе этого курса мы изучим синтаксис Руби и научимся писать программы на нем.
Кому подойдет курс
начинающим программистам
Чему вы обучаетесь на курсе
синтаксису Руби и научитесь писать программы на нем
Программа курса
Урок 1: Переменные и типы данных
В ходе урока мы изучим работу с переменными, а также разберем типы данных, которые присутствуют в языке Ruby. Также мы создадим несколько программ с применением переменных.
Урок 2: Строки и математические действия
В ходе этого урока мы познакомимся со строками, узнаем про их возможности и методы, а также рассмотрим тему математических операций. Мы поработаем над классом Math, который служит для работы с математическими функциями.
Урок 3: Получение данных от пользователя
В ходе урока мы научимся получать данные от пользователя, а также скачаем специальный плагин, который позволит запустить терминал прямиком из текстового редактора Atom.
Урок 4: Массивы и ассоциативные массивы
Массивы состоят из множества элементов и позволяют работать с каждым из них. Мы рассмотрим создание массивов, их наполнение, а также вывод на экран. Также мы научимся работать с ассоциативными массивами и индексами.
Урок 5: Методы и оператор return
Методы это небольшие подпрограммы, которые отлично помогают сократить код. В уроке мы научимся их создавать и ознакомимся с оператором return.
Урок 6: Условные операторы
Условные операторы способны проверить условие и в зависимости от проверки выдать необходимый результат. Мы изучим работу с оператором if else, а также изучим оператор switch when.
Урок 7: Цикл While и цикл For
Циклы позволяют выполнять код несколько раз подряд. В ходе урока мы разберемся с циклами while, for и times, а также научимся работать с ними на различных примерах.
Урок 8: Работа с файлами (чтение и запись)
При помощи Ruby можно работать с файлами на компьютере или же на сервере. В этом видео мы научимся читать, а также записывать данные в файл при помощи Ruby.
Урок 9: Отслеживание ошибок
Отслеживание ошибок помогает отлавливать ошибки и не останавливать приложения даже в случае фатальной ошибки. Такие исключения служат для обработки всех возможных сценариев программы.
Урок 10: Объекты и классы (ООП)
В ходе этого урока мы ознакомимся с базовыми понятиями ООП. Мы научимся создавать классы и объекты, а также рассмотрим работу с конструкторами класса.
Урок 11: Наследование, модули и завершение курса
В этом уроке мы изучим одну из концепций ООП - наследование классов. Также мы затронем тему модулей и научимся создавать их и подключать в другие файлы.
Организатор курса
Куратор отвечает за 5 минут
Видео курсы по HTML, CSS, PHP, JavaScript, Ajax, различным фреймворкам и движкам, которые обеспечивают быстрое и эффективное создание веб сайта.
Также вы можете обучиться перспективным и мощным языкам программирования, таким как: C++, C#, Java, Python, Си, Swift, Go и многим другим языкам.
Если же вас интересуют игры и вы хотите научиться их создавать, то вы найдете множество курсов по созданию игр на различных игровых движках (Unity, Unreal Engine, GameMaker, Corona SDK), а также без использования движков на чистом С++, Java или Python!